Hello @budbud570 ,
If your issues started on or about September 30 or slightly after, Iâd first would briefly remove the âQuick Release Battery Packâ from your Video Doorbell (or if your model does not have a removal battery youâll probably need to do a reset). Then secondly, try toggling ON and back OFF (vice-a-versa) your Ring App settings that have recently started âactingâ differently. Youâve already done some of these setting changes, but if you did them on the 29th or 30th, you probably should do them again.
Iâve been reading posts across several of the Community forum rooms, and there was a slight surge of weird malfunctions that included Doorbells ringing randomly, Chimes & Chime Proâs sounding, camera video recording malfunctions, inability to connect or view âLive Viewâ, Notifications being âpushâ to their App even when toggled off, periods of no video or snapshots recorded, etc. This all started on Sept 29th and 30th and afterwards. I donât know if it is a coincidence or not , but suspect it might have something to do with the Ring Servers âoutageâ that day.
OR use your Ring App and check âDevice Healthâ and scroll & select âRing System Status.â
So apparently the Ring technicians were âfixingâ the main Ring computer servers at about the time many of these weird issues started. Many previous notifications that were stored in the Ring Servers probably started pouring out after the âfix.â
Also many devices were adversely impacted or disconnected from the Ring Server. I read post where people had to reset their devices afterwards to stop the continuing weird behavior. I was lucky enough and found just removing power from my affected devices (unplugging them from the house outlet, or briefly removing the battery) avoided the need for a reset, but still returned my devices back to normal operation. So you should give that a try too.
Also, because your Ring App settings are not stored in your phone, but actually are stored in the Ring Servers under your Ring email account, myself and some other people had to " re-send" the stored settings back to the Ring Server, by âtogglingâ their Notifications and Chirp Tones, ON and then back OFF (or vice-a-versa), even though the App still displayed the last known correct preference settings, in order to correct the issues. Sounds like it probably would be something for you to try, cycling your App settings to a different setting, and then back to your preferred setting (like the toggling on your âRecordingâ and Ring Alerts" and âMotion Alertsâ). Hopefully you can avoid performing a Factory Reset (holding reset button > 20-seconds and then completing the setup and firmware download), but that would be my next step.
So Iâm not positive this was the cause of your issue, but it seems to be helping if for others that just recently starting noticing issues after the 30th.
If your issues were occurring prior to the 29th and/or removing power/reseting device and re-doing your Appâs affected settings all doesnât work for you. I would next try a âhardâ Factory Reset on your Doorbell to clean out any potential corrupted downloaded firmware (press & hold reset button for > 20-seconds and then complete the setup).
